Info Racing Review

Info Racing have produced a terrible set of results in month three, as they have struggled to find any winners, achieving just the 3 places out of 25 bets. In three months, my bank has decreased by 39% at the available prices and at BSP, a slightly worse 46.8% decrease. Going into the fourth month in the

Read More